Bright Data vs PacketStream
Bright Data (4.6/5) and PacketStream (3.8/5) are both popular proxy networks. Here is how they compare on price, pool, and performance.
Quick answer
Bright Data rates higher overall (4.6 vs 3.8), largely on one of the largest residential ip pools in the industry. PacketStream still wins for buyers who prioritise rock-bottom budgets.
Side by side
| Provider | Rating | Pricing | Pool | Best for |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Bright Data | 4.6/5 | subscription | 150M+ residential IPs | Enterprise scraping |
| PacketStream | 3.8/5 | pay-as-you-go | 7M+ residential IPs | Rock-bottom budgets |
Bright Data strengths
- One of the largest residential IP pools in the industry
- Full stack: residential, ISP, datacenter, and mobile proxies
- Advanced tools like Web Unlocker, SERP API, and scraping browsers
- Granular geo-targeting, strong compliance, and KYC controls
- Highly reliable network with enterprise SLAs and uptime
PacketStream strengths
- One of the lowest per-GB residential prices on the market
- Simple pay-as-you-go model with no monthly minimums
- Easy setup for basic scraping and lightweight automation
- Traffic credits that suit intermittent, low-volume use

Frequently Asked Questions
Which has the bigger proxy pool?
Bright Data lists 150M+ residential IPs and PacketStream lists 7M+ residential IPs. Bigger pools help with rotation and hard targets, but freshness matters as much as raw size.
Is Bright Data better than PacketStream?
Bright Data rates slightly higher overall (4.6 vs 3.8), but PacketStream can be the better fit for specific needs.
Which is cheaper, Bright Data or PacketStream?
Bright Data uses subscription pricing (~$8-9/GB) and PacketStream uses pay-as-you-go pricing (~$1/GB). Compare on your expected monthly volume, since per-GB rates drop with scale.
